Jamie purchased a DVD that was on sale for 15% off. The sales tax in her county is 5%. Let y represent the original price of the DVD. Write an expression that can be used to determine the final cost of the DVD.

a. y − 0.15y
b. 0.05(0.85y)
c. y − 0.85y + 0.05y
d. 1.05(0.85y)

Answer: Option 'D' is correct.

Explanation:

Since we have given that

Sale off = 15%

Rate of sales tax = 5%

Let y be the original price of the DVD.

Amount of sales tax would be


(5)/(100)* y\\\\=0.05y

Amount after tax would be

y + 0.05 y = 1.05y

Now, there is off of 15%, so final cost of the DVD would be


(100-15)/(100)* 1.05y\\\\=(85)/(100)* 1.05y\\\\=0.85(1.05y)

Hence, Option 'D' is correct.
